问题:.mp4视频不能以html格式播放,但可以播放相同格式的视频。
回答:
.mp4是一种常见的视频文件格式,它通常使用H.264视频编码和AAC音频编码。在HTML中,视频可以通过使用HTML5的<video>标签来嵌入和播放。然而,有时候在使用HTML格式播放视频时,.mp4视频可能无法正常播放。
这可能是由于以下几个原因导致的:
- 编解码器支持:浏览器需要支持特定的视频编解码器才能播放相应的视频格式。尽管.mp4是一种常见的格式,但不同的浏览器可能对其支持的编解码器有所不同。因此,如果浏览器不支持视频文件中使用的编解码器,那么该视频将无法以HTML格式播放。
- 浏览器兼容性:不同的浏览器对HTML5标准的支持程度也有所不同。某些浏览器可能无法正确解析和播放某些视频格式,即使这些格式在其他浏览器中可以正常播放。
解决这个问题的方法有几种:
- 转码视频:如果您的视频无法以HTML格式播放,您可以尝试将其转码为其他常见的视频格式,如WebM或Ogg。这样可以增加视频在不同浏览器中的兼容性。
- 使用视频转换工具:有许多免费或付费的视频转换工具可用于将视频从一种格式转换为另一种格式。您可以搜索并选择适合您需求的工具进行转换。
- 使用第三方播放器:如果您无法通过HTML5标签播放视频,您可以考虑使用第三方的视频播放器插件或库,如Video.js或jPlayer。这些播放器通常具有更好的兼容性和功能,可以帮助您在网页中播放各种视频格式。
总结起来,如果您的.mp4视频无法以HTML格式播放,可能是由于浏览器不支持特定的编解码器或存在兼容性问题。您可以尝试转码视频或使用第三方播放器来解决这个问题。